Need more features

K. Seales

I like the ability to see which aisle a product is on but it’s so small. Why is the product size in bold but the aisle info so small? I think those need to be switched design wise. Also it would be great if you could share lists other than email. The ability to edit lists with the people you share it with would really help a lot. Another feature that would be great would be the ability for the app to scan your grocery list and be able to see if there are coupons for anything already added to your list rather than you having to scan the coupons and then add. Also if you have this feature, it would also be good to suggest similar products if the one you selected doesn’t have an associated coupon.

Needs search filters

JMelz76

This app is great in the sense that it organizes your grocery list based on the items location in the store and allows you to organize electronic coupons. I just wish they would add a search filter that would only show items carried by the H-E-B I selected as my store. Instead, it just adds the item you selected to your list with a note that it is not available. Then you have to delete it, do another search and hope that the next option you pick is available in your store because there is nothing to indicate if it is or not in the search list. Please fix this.
